Transaction 5127c6f77df26fabb9cafa0cb15e28f23c3048b83b7012d8aa29dceb86536584

1 Input
1 Outputs
  • 5127c6f77df26fabb9cafa0cb15e28f23c3048b83b7012d8aa29dceb86536584:0
  • value  619206
    address  1HecydxjXDvXD8mmY3iHziCUqdzMa9vf5a